2012 Volkswagen Passat SE
2012 Volkswagen Passat SE - Editors' Notebook - Automobile Magazine
The all-new Passat hails from Tennessee; is it up to snuff?

Much has been said about the 2012 Passat: It is the second of Volkswagen's new "Americanized" cars and the first to come from its all-new factory in Chattanooga, Tennessee. The new plant seems up to snuff in the initial-quality department, with panels all screwed together well and with reasonably tight panel gaps. I say "reasonably" because Fisher Price-grade plastics can fit together only so tightly. While the cabin may be attractively designed, there are few soft-touch plastics to be found and too many that are reminiscent of the little red-and-yellow buggy many of us had as children.

JAPAN: July output fall lessens

Stay connected Subscribe to our RSS feed
Japan's eight major automakers produced 750,076 vehicles in July, down 9.4% year on year, yet an improvement from the 15.2% fall in June, as they continued to recover from the disruptions caused by the 11 March earthquake and tsunami.

JAPAN: August vehicle sales off 22.4%

Stay connected Subscribe to our RSS feed
New vehicle sales in Japan, including minivehicles, fell 22.4% year on year in August to 329,838 units, the 11th straight month of decline, the Japan Automobile Dealers Association and the Japan Mini Vehicles Association said.
